logo

Output f8a3a22ee21e863eb08f41012245da4bba6f17ff74b5b9bec67e18ba61dc2311:1

value
350027940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d943ebd5b026211e0af7daad97f1ea6eb51e8972 OP_EQUAL
address
3MVovRMWNKKACJSstEpS37jXTuT6SBxN3L
transaction
f8a3a22ee21e863eb08f41012245da4bba6f17ff74b5b9bec67e18ba61dc2311